Here’s a color palette that transitions from light to dark shades of red, featuring six distinct colors:
### Palette Name: **Crimson Spectrum**
1. **Light Pinkish Red**
- **Color Name:** Light Salmon
- **Hex Code:**
#FF9999
- **Description:** A soft, delicate shade of red that brings warmth and lightness, perfect for creating a gentle and inviting atmosphere.
2. **Peachy Red**
- **Color Name:** Light Coral
- **Hex Code:**
#FF7F7F
- **Description:** A vibrant yet light hue that captures the essence of summer, offering a cheerful and lively feel.
3. **Bright Red**
- **Color Name:** Fire Engine Red
- **Hex Code:**
#FF4C4C
- **Description:** A bold and striking red that commands attention, ideal for focal points and energetic designs.
4. **Cherry Red**
- **Color Name:** Cherry
- **Hex Code:**
#C72C30
- **Description:** This classic shade of red carries depth and richness, evoking feelings of passion and excitement.
5. **Dark Red**
- **Color Name:** Crimson
- **Hex Code:**
#9B1B30
- **Description:** A deep and intense red that suggests elegance and sophistication, suitable for more formal or dramatic designs.
6. **Deep Red**
- **Color Name:** Burgundy
- **Hex Code:**
#6A0A13
- **Description:** A rich, dark red that adds a touch of luxury and warmth, perfect for creating a cozy and inviting environment.
### Palette Description:
The **Crimson Spectrum** palette seamlessly transitions from light and airy shades to deep, rich reds, making it versatile for various applications. Whether you're designing for a romantic setting, a bold brand identity, or a warm interior, this palette offers a comprehensive range of red hues that evoke a spectrum of emotions and atmospheres.

Understanding Contrast Ratios
4.5:1 (Level AA)
The minimum required contrast ratio for normal text to be considered accessible under WCAG 2.1 Level AA. For large text, the requirement is lower at 3.0:1. This is the standard target for most web content.
7.0:1 (Level AAA)
The "gold standard" for accessibility. Achieving a 7.0:1 ratio ensures that your text is readable even for people with significant vision loss. For large text, the AAA requirement is 4.5:1.
What counts as Large Text?
WCAG defines large text as anything 18pt (approx. 24px) or larger, or 14pt (approx. 18.66px) and bold or larger. Most headings fall into this category.
Why it matters
Proper contrast is essential for everyone, but especially for people with color blindness, low vision, or those viewing screens in bright sunlight.
